Fit2Ride
The road safety guide for people who want to cycle
Fit2Ride is a new free publication produced by Devon County Council. It is available free to individuals, families, companies and interested groups in Plymouth.
Millions of people enjoy the freedom, fun and improved health that cycling can bring. Fit2Ride is a step by step guide which shows people how to become an able and safe cyclist - regardless of age or initial cycling ability. The guide is split into two sections.
Zone 1 - off the road
For beginners or people who don’t feel confident when they are cycling. At first, it is important to have lots of practice in a safe area, off the road
This will enable you to develop knowledge of how your bicycle works, basic bicycle handling skills and how you can help to keep yourself safe once you start using the roads.
Zone 2 - on the road
For cyclists who have already achieved a good standard of cycling knowledge and skills off the road.
When you have developed confidence, good observation, bicycle handling skills, you may wish to travel on quiet roads. This is when you will become part of the traffic and must follow all traffic rules, traffic signs and signals. You will also need to be considerate towards other road users including walkers, young children, the elderly and people with disabilities.
